Ecclesiastes 1:3
What does a man gain from all his labor,
from Everything Is Futile, Ecclesiastes 1:1-11
What it says

He asks what lasting profit comes from all human labor under the sun.

What it is doing

This verse frames the book's central inquiry into gain.
